Ucore Readies for Louisiana 2026 Heavy Rare Earth Element Processing
Newsfile· 2025-12-11 15:07
Core Insights - Ucore Rare Metals Inc. is advancing its RapidSX™ rare earth element separation technology and is set to transition its operations to a new facility in Alexandria, Louisiana, by 2026, supported by a USD$22.4 million agreement with the U.S. Department of War [1][2][8] Group 1: Technology and Operations - The company has been operating its 52-Stage RapidSX™ Demonstration Plant in Kingston, Ontario, since December 2023, focusing on improving the technology for future deployment in Louisiana [2][3] - The Louisiana Strategic Metals Complex (SMC) will produce mid and heavy rare earth elements, including terbium (Tb) and dysprosium (Dy), with potential for neodymium-praseodymium (NdPr) production [2][5] - Ucore has completed approximately 5,700 hours of rare earth element processing, demonstrating the capability to produce various rare earth element groups [6][7] Group 2: Project Development and Achievements - The company has established a continuous improvement program for the RapidSX™ technology platform, allowing for quick reconfiguration of operational equipment for specific separation needs [7] - Ucore has analyzed over 25,000 samples, confirming that RapidSX™ yields results comparable to conventional solvent extraction methods [7] - The company is on track for the installation of RapidSX™ Machine 1 in mid-2026, with ongoing field engineering, permitting, and procurement activities [7][8] Group 3: Strategic Vision and Market Position - Ucore aims to disrupt the control of rare earth element supply chains by the People's Republic of China through the development of processing facilities in the U.S. and Canada [10] - The company plans to expand its operations to include additional strategic metals complexes in Canada and Alaska, alongside its Bokan-Dotson Ridge Rare Heavy REE Project [10]

Ucore Enters into Strategic Partnership with Metallium Limited
Newsfile· 2025-09-16 12:30
Core Viewpoint - Ucore Rare Metals Inc. has signed a strategic technology collaboration agreement with Metallium Limited to enhance rare earth refining capabilities through the integration of Metallium's Flash Joule Heating technology with Ucore's RapidSX technology [1][4][12] Collaboration Details - The partnership aims to combine Metallium's FJH process, which upgrades rare earth mineral concentrates to Mixed Rare Earth Chlorides (MREC), with Ucore's RapidSX technology for refining at its Louisiana facility [2][4] - The collaboration will explore alternative feedstocks, including magnet scrap, e-waste, and lighting waste, to produce separated rare earth oxides (REOs) such as neodymium-praseodymium (NdPr), dysprosium (Dy), and terbium (Tb) [4][7] Technological Integration - Metallium's FJH technology serves as an upstream upgrading step, producing high-purity mixed REE chloride intermediates that are then refined into individual REOs using Ucore's RapidSX separation platform [10][11] - The integrated flowsheet is designed to be scalable and capable of processing a wide range of REE-bearing feedstocks, including primary mineral concentrates and recycled materials [10][11] Strategic Importance - The collaboration supports Ucore's goal of establishing a robust rare earth supply chain in North America, reducing reliance on Chinese sources and enhancing domestic production capabilities [3][14] - Ucore's RapidSX technology is recognized for its modular and scalable nature, which is essential for separating individual rare earth oxides from diverse feedstock sources [3][4] Future Steps - The agreement includes a staged program for testing and pilot operations, with initial bench-scale testing focusing on processing Ucore-supplied rare earth concentrate through Metallium's FJH system [7][12] - The second stage will involve pilot-scale production of mixed REE chlorides for processing at Ucore's Commercial Demonstration Plant in Kingston, Ontario [7][12]
Ucore Launches US Department of Defense Funded $18.4 Million Commercial Rare Earth Refining Project
Newsfile· 2025-07-14 14:25
Core Insights - Ucore Rare Metals Inc. has initiated a formal project kick-off meeting with the US Department of Defense regarding an USD$18.4 million Phase 2 Award aimed at constructing a commercial-scale RapidSX™ machine in Louisiana for heavy rare earth elements [1][2][3] Phase 1 and Phase 2 Awards - The Phase 2 Award supplements a previously announced USD$4 million Phase 1 Award, which demonstrated the efficacy of RapidSX™ in processing rare earths necessary for permanent magnets, including dysprosium [2][4] - The Phase 1 Award has resulted in successful separation of critical heavy rare earth elements, leading to a payment of USD$1.1 million, bringing total payments for Phase 1 to USD$3.35 million [5][7] Importance of Heavy Rare Earth Elements (HREEs) - HREEs are essential for US national security, playing a crucial role in advanced military technologies such as precision-guided missiles and F-35 jet engines, as well as in electric vehicles and renewable energy [3][9] - Ucore's partnership with the DOD aims to mitigate vulnerabilities in the supply chain, particularly as China restricts exports of these materials [3][9] Project Milestones and Deliverables - The project will focus on constructing a commercial-scale RapidSX™ machine, with milestones including commissioning and achieving early production readiness of rare earth products [4][5] - Detailed design and engineering work is ongoing at Ucore's facilities in Kingston, Ontario, and Alexandria, Louisiana [6] Strategic Initiatives and Future Plans - Ucore supports the DOD's initiatives to strengthen the domestic rare earth supply chain, including pricing floors and offtake commitments to enhance industry stability [9] - The company plans to disrupt China's control over the North American REE supply chain through the development of processing facilities in Louisiana and Alaska, as well as the Bokan-Dotson Ridge project in Alaska [11]
